Re: [Ubuntu-phone] [Bug 1475915] Re: as receiver of messages switch-off received notifications

2015-07-24 Thread Roberto Resoli

Il 23/07/2015 07:42, Matthias Apitz ha scritto:

The point is, that even between trusted and identified person every side
should be able to let the sender in the unsureness if the message
arrived to his/her eyes or not. This is what privacy is called and which
is violated by Telegram.

matthias


I agree with Mathias, this conceptually is the same as in return 
receipts in ordinary email; it is a feature implemented by Mail User 
Agents, and every (serious) Mail User Agent permits the user to disable it.


If this feature is part of the Telegram protocol, the protocol itself is 
seriously broken, and in that case I will avoid at all Telegram usage.


MDNs (RFC 3798) are a formalization of Return Receipts , but exactly 
for the same privacy reasons Mathias refers to, requests for MDNs are 
entirely advisory in nature - i.e. recipients are free to ignore such 
requests:


https://en.wikipedia.or/wiki/Return_receipt#Message_disposition_notifications

Re: [Ubuntu-phone] mirscreencast from terminal app

2015-06-23 Thread Roberto Resoli

Il 23/06/2015 10:45, Daniel van Vugt ha scritto:

Sorry, I found the problem. Should have tested it myself earlier...

The problem is Unity8 and again this is probably a feature more than a
bug. It's suspending (sending SIGSTOP) not just to the terminal app but
also all child processes of the terminal app. So you can't easily avoid
getting suspended :(

Maybe if you can move your background process to a different process
group or session you can avoid getting suspended by Unity8 but I haven't
found any command that works yet...


It works from inside an ssh session; no terminal app, no suspend. It 
works beautifully :-)

Re: [Ubuntu-phone] importing contacts

2015-04-12 Thread Roberto Resoli



Su domenica 12 aprile 2015 11:31:44 CEST, Roberto Resoli ha scritto:
Il 12 aprile 2015 11:15:31 CEST, Roberto Resoli 
robe...@resolutions.it ha scritto:

Il 12 aprile 2015 10:40:38 CEST, Matthias Apitz g...@unixarea.de ha
scritto:


...
Here I am. The procedure requires you have your contacts in one 
or more .vcf files. Assuming the file to be:  
/home/phablet/Documents/contacts.vcf you can import using this 
command:


syncevolution --import /home/phablet/Documents/contacts.vcf 
backend=evolution-contacts database=Personal


Just retested the procedure; 

Important: omit the database=Personal parameter. 

If you have many vcf, put them in a directory e pass the directory as 
--import argument


In my case I had a single vcf per contact, so i iterated the 
command over the entire fileset.


I found this solution on AskUbuntu:  http://askubuntu.com/a/372342

Re: [Ubuntu-phone] using the BQ as a router

2015-04-04 Thread Roberto Resoli
Il 04/04/2015 18:40, Matthias Apitz ha scritto:
 
 Hello,
 
 While I have connected my netbook to the BQ via USB, and the BQ to the
 Internet via GSM/UMTS, can I use the BQ as a router? 
 Is gateway enabled in
 the kernel 

Yes:

phablet@ubuntu-phablet:~$ cat /proc/sys/net/ipv4/ip_forward
1


and the outgoing traffic NAT'ed behind its interfac to the
 provider?

Yes:

phablet@ubuntu-phablet:~$ sudo iptables -t nat -nvL POSTROUTING
Chain POSTROUTING (policy ACCEPT 167 packets, 10533 bytes)
 pkts bytes target prot opt in out source
destination
   22  1636 MASQUERADE  all  --  *  *   10.42.0.0/24
!10.42.0.0/24
